Market Overview

The Battery Factory Protective Suit market was valued at USD 142.3 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 305.6 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 6.9% during the forecast period. The surge in electric vehicle (EV) production and lithium-ion battery manufacturing is a primary factor fueling demand. Protective suits in battery factories provide not only chemical and thermal protection but also ergonomic comfort for workers performing extended tasks, enhancing operational efficiency and safety compliance.

Key Market Drivers

Rapid Growth of Battery Manufacturing

The rising global adoption of electric vehicles, renewable energy storage, and portable electronics has driven significant growth in battery production. Battery factories require strict safety measures to protect workers from hazardous chemicals like lithium, nickel, and cobalt. As production scales, the demand for specialized protective suits grows, driving the market forward.

Stringent Safety Regulations

Regulatory bodies across North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ific enforce stringent occupational safety standards in battery manufacturing facilities. Compliance with OSHA (Occupational Safety and Health Administration) regulations, EU chemical safety directives, and regional guidelines necessitates the use of certified protective suits, propelling market demand and ensuring widespread adoption.

Technological Advancements

Innovations in materials science and manufacturing have led to the development of lightweight, flame-retardant, and anti-static protective suits. These advanced suits offer superior chemical and thermal resistance, comfort, and flexibility. Integration of smart textiles with sensors for monitoring worker health and environmental conditions is an emerging trend enhancing safety in battery factories.

Market Segmentation

By Type

The market is segmented into chemical-resistant suits, flame-retardant suits, anti-static suits, and multi-functional protective suits. Chemical-resistant suits currently dominate the market due to their critical role in preventing chemical exposure in battery production lines. Multi-functional suits, which combine thermal protection, chemical resistance, and ergonomic comfort, are projected to experience the fastest growth, with a CAGR of 7.4% from 2025 to 2035.

By Application

Applications of Battery Factory Protective Suits span electric vehicle battery production, consumer electronics battery manufacturing, and industrial energy storage battery production. The EV battery segment accounts for the largest market share, driven by the exponential growth of the global EV industry. Industrial energy storage applications are also emerging as key contributors, particularly in regions investing heavily in renewable energy infrastructure.

By Region

Geographically, North America led the market in 2024, holding over 35% of global revenue due to advanced battery manufacturing facilities and strict occupational safety regulations. Europe follows closely, benefiting from stringent EU safety directives and a growing EV manufacturing ecosystem. Asia-Pacific is projected to witness the highest growth rate of 8.2% during the forecast period, fueled by expanding battery production in China, Japan, and South Korea to meet domestic and global demand.

Competitive Landscape

The Battery Factory Protective Suit market is moderately fragmented, with key players focusing on product innovation, strategic collaborations, and regional expansion. Major companies include 3M Company, DuPont, Honeywell International Inc., Lakeland Industries, and Ansell Limited. These companies are enhancing their product portfolios with lightweight, ergonomic, and multi-functional protective suits to cater to the evolving needs of battery manufacturing workers.
